15The unit requires no maintenance. A damp cloth can be used to wipe away any dirt. Ensurethat the unit is first disconnected from the mains power sup

2.3. Product DescriptionThe digital Transmitter HPT 100 enables total pressure measurements in the range of 7.5 x 10-10... 750 Torr (1x10-9... 1000 mb
